03 / The rhythm section

Infrastructure is equal parts precision and listening.

Founder Lee Whalen came to systems work through campus servers, email, and DNS. He also came through years as a professional bassist: performing, recording, touring, and learning how strong ensembles respond in real time.

That same instinct shapes Fuzzy Logic today. Understand the environment. Find the constraint. Make the intervention count. Support the people carrying the work forward.
